A professional locksmith can provide a series of services to assist you with your car keys. Here are a few of the most common services:
Key Duplication: This service involves developing a precise copy of your existing car key. It's simple for conventional metal keys however can be more complex for keys with electronic parts.Key Programming: Many contemporary automobiles have transponder keys that require to be programmed to the vehicle's computer system. A locksmith can program a brand-new key to ensure it works seamlessly with your car.Key Extraction: If your key breaks off in the lock, a locksmith can safely remove it without triggering damage to the lock or the vehicle.Lock Repair and Replacement: If your car lock is harmed or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it, guaranteeing that your vehicle stays safe.Emergency Situation Lockout Assistance: In the event that you are locked out of your car, a locksmith can supply fast and efficient assistance to get you back in.Tips for Choosing the Right LocksmithInspect Credentials: Verify that the locksmith is certified and certified. Q: How much does a locksmith generally charge for car key services?A: The expense can vary depending on the service and the locksmith. Key duplication for a conventional metal key can cost between ₤ 10 and ₤ 50, while programming a transponder key can range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150. Emergency situation services may be more expensive, but lots of locksmith professionals use flat rates or discounts.

Q: Can a locksmith replace a lost key fob?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can replace a lost key fob. They can program a brand-new fob to work with your vehicle's system, often at a lower expense than a car dealership.

Q: What should I do if my key breaks in the lock?A: If your key breaks in the lock, do not attempt to require it out. Call a locksmith who can safely extract the broken piece and produce a new key for you.

Q: Are locksmith professionals readily available 24/7?A: Many locksmith professionals offer 24/7 emergency services. It's a good idea to ask about their accessibility when you contact them.

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to show up?A: The arrival time can vary depending upon the locksmith's schedule and your place. Most locksmiths intend to arrive within 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Can a locksmith aid with keyless entry systems?A: Yes, a locksmith can aid with keyless entry systems. They can detect issues, replace batteries, and reprogram the system if required.
